  • Currently working as Product Designer for Citrix Director. It is a management console in the XenDesktop and XenApp virtualization platforms that allows administrators to control and monitor virtual desktops and applications. With the Citrix Director console, information technology (IT) administrators can view XenDesktop and XenApp session details, disconnect or restart sessions, view customizable trend reports, shadow or control users sessions and set alerts associated with company policies. Director allows IT administrators to set up the console for unified deployment monitoring or configure a custom interface that provides help desk staff with resources to troubleshoot user-specific issues.
